JCHX orders Sandvik underground fleet for KCM contract in Botswana
JCHX has booked an order with Sandvik for a 45-unit fleet of underground mining equipment for use at MMG’s Khoemacau Copper Mine (KCM) in Botswana.

John Crane, a global leader in flow control technologies and a business of Smiths Group plc, has retrofitted a mechanical seal on a large underflow thickener slurry pump at a major copper mining operation, cutting the clean water needed for sealing by around 288 000 litres per day and supporting a move away from frequent, high-risk maintenance interventions on a production-critical asset.
